Extended Data Fig. 2: Average annual food flows (Mt/year) from 2000 to 2018. Food flows between high-hotspot countries (HHC), low-hotspot countries (LHC), and non-hotspot countries (NHC) with high- and low-income.

From: International food trade benefits biodiversity and food security in low-income countries

Extended Data Fig. 2

Non-hotspot countries are marked by red, high-hotspot countries by dark green, and low-hotspot countries by light green. The arc length of an outer circle indicates the sum of food exported and imported in each group. The arc length of a middle circle refers to the quantity of food exports. The inner arc length shows the quantity of food imports. Raw data from UN FAO52.
